(please see scans) ***46 pages. 220mm x 165mm. ***Contents: The Naming of Cats, The Old Gumbie Cat, Growltiger's Last Stand, The Rum Tum Tugger, The Song of the Jellicles, Mungojerrie and Rumpleteazer, Old Deuteronomy, The Pekes and the Pollicles, Mr. Mistoffelees, Macavity: the Mystery Cat, Gus: the Theatre Cat, Bustopher Jones: the Cat about Town, Skimbleshanks: the Railway Cat, The Ad-dressing of Cats. ***"They are irresistible, impossible and magnificent." - Books of Today. ***An eleventh impression of the true first edition, also stated as a New Edition, published in 1953, in its original dustwrapper. First published in 1939, the first illustrated edition (with pictures by Nicolas Bentley) was issued by Faber & Faber in 1940. This new edition, with numerous fabulous illsustrations by the great Edward Gorey, was first issued by Harcourt, Brace, Jovanovich in New York in 1982; this is the first UK edition with Gorey's illustrations.
